1. Major Advances in Language Models

A prominent development in AI is the major advances in language models. Models such as GPT-4 and BERT, built on deep learning and large neural networks, have achieved notable success in natural language processing, text generation, and sentiment analysis. These models can understand and generate human language with high accuracy and are widely used in chatbots, search engines, and media content analysis.

2. Generative AI

Generative AI, which creates new content from input data, is a cutting-edge trend in the field. Generative models like GANs (Generative Adversarial Networks) and VAEs (Variational Autoencoders) can produce images, text, and even music. These technologies are transforming design, digital art, and content production, sparking new creative possibilities.

3. AI for Big Data Analytics

Today’s world generates massive volumes of data that require advanced analysis. AI, using complex algorithms and machine learning, can analyze big data quickly and accurately. New techniques such as AutoML (Automated Machine Learning) and predictive analytics help organizations extract valuable insights and make better decisions.

4. Reinforcement Learning and Its Applications

Reinforcement Learning (RL) is an exciting AI trend that enables models to learn optimal strategies through interaction with their environment. This approach is widely used in video games, robotics, and autonomous decision-making systems. RL algorithms like Q-learning and Deep Q-Networks (DQN) are rapidly advancing and finding new applications across various domains.

5. AI in Healthcare and Medicine

AI in healthcare is evolving rapidly with numerous novel applications. From medical image analysis and disease diagnosis to treatment outcome prediction and personalized medicine, AI empowers clinicians and researchers to improve care quality. Machine learning algorithms can detect complex patterns in medical data and enable early disease detection.

6. Ethics and Responsibility in AI

As AI usage expands, ethical and responsibility issues become critical. Concerns such as data privacy, algorithmic bias, and transparency in AI decision-making demand regulatory attention. Researchers and organizations are developing ethical frameworks and technological solutions to ensure AI is used fairly and responsibly.

7. AI in Industrial Automation and Robotics

Industrial automation and robotics are also being transformed by AI. Smart robots performing repetitive and complex tasks in various industries reduce costs and boost production efficiency. AI techniques like computer vision and adaptive control enable robots to operate autonomously with high precision.

8. AI Applications in Transportation and Autonomous Vehicles

Self-driving cars and intelligent transportation systems represent another major AI application. AI technologies allow vehicles to autonomously plan routes and navigate obstacles with high accuracy. These systems enhance driving experience and road safety.

9. AI Interaction with the Internet of Things (IoT)

With the growth of IoT, AI-IoT integration has become a key trend. AI analyzes data from IoT devices to optimize performance and predict maintenance needs. This synergy finds extensive use in smart homes, manufacturing, and energy management.
